Go语言的vim高亮

Go语言自带vim 的语法高亮文件。
将$GOSRC/misc/vim/目录下文件拷贝到~/.vim/目录下(如果没有该目录则新建)
新建~/.vim/ftdetect/go.vim
加入下面的内容:

au BufRead,BufNewFile *.go set filetype=go

-EOF-

编辑文件vi命令用法

模式转换:

命令模式下的命令:

//命令	解释
:x	保存之后退出
:wq	保存之后退出
:w	保存文件
:q	退出
:q!	不存盘就退出
:set number	在每行开始显示行数
h	光标左移
j	光标下移
k	光标上移
l	光标右移
0	光标移到本行的开头
$	光标移到本行的末尾
a	在当前位置之后添加
i	在当前的位置前面插入
o	在当前行的下面建一个新行
O	在当前行的上面建一个新行
数字G	跳至第“数字”行(无数字时跳到文件末尾)
数字yy	复制多少行(无数字时复制光标行)
数字dd	删除多少行(无数字时删除光标行)
p	在当前行的下面粘贴
u	撤消上一次的命令操作(可撤销多次操作)
D	从光标位置删除到本行行末
x	删除当前字符
X	删除前一个字符

-EOF-